Abstract:
The paper presents a system identification method that can determine individual room air change rates in commercial building HVAC systems. This is achieved by utilizing a combined low order model based on the room's thermal dynamics and experimental approach. The low order model is shown to capture the dominant dynamics of the room air temperature response. This method can help enable significant building energy use reduction by reassessing the air flow rates needed for each room in a building.
